In a significant matchup, Panathinaikos is set to face Real Betis for the first time in any European competition at the Spyros Louis Stadium. This encounter marks a pivotal moment for both teams as they navigate their respective challenges in the UEFA Europa League.

Immediate Circumstances

Panathinaikos enters this match with a troubling record, having secured just one win in their last 18 games against Spanish teams. In contrast, Real Betis has shown resilience, losing only one of their last 12 away major European knockout matches. The stakes are high, especially considering Panathinaikos’ recent performance, where they drew their last five UEFA Europa League matches.

During the Europa League league phase, Panathinaikos finished with 12 points from eight matches, scoring 11 goals while conceding nine. Real Betis, on the other hand, performed strongly, accumulating 17 points and winning four of their last five matches in the tournament.

Historically, Panathinaikos has struggled against Spanish teams in European competitions, which adds pressure to their current campaign. The team recently faced a challenging two-match showdown with Viktoria Plzen, ultimately winning through a penalty shootout. However, they are currently dealing with significant losses due to injuries and suspensions, which could impact their performance.

Real Betis has also faced challenges in Greece, having played two away UEFA Europa League matches without a win or a goal. This adds an interesting dynamic to their upcoming match against Panathinaikos.

As the match approaches, both teams are preparing to address their respective weaknesses. Panathinaikos has notably won in the first half in five consecutive matches, showcasing their potential to start strong. Meanwhile, Real Betis aims to break their streak of poor performances in Greece.
